北邮高级语言程序设计(基于Java)第三次阶段作业
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
北邮高级语言程序设计(基于Java)第三次阶段作业
一、单项选择题(共20道小题,共100、0分)
1.下面哪个修饰符修饰得变量就是所有同一个类生成得对象共享得?____
A.public
B.private
C.static
D.final
知识点: 第三单元过关自测
学生答
案:
[A;]
得分: [5] 试题分
值:
5、0
提示:
2.以下哪个接口得定义就是正确得_____
A.interface A
{void print(){};}
B.abstract interface A
{void print();}
C.abstract interface A extends I1, I2 // I1、I2为已
定义得接口
abstract void print(){ };}
D.interface A
{void print();}
知识点: 第三单元过关自测
学生答
案:
[D;]
得分: [5] 试题分
值:
5、0
提示:
3.下列说法正确得就是____
A.子类只能覆盖父类得方法,而不能重载
B.子类只能重载父类得方法,而不能覆盖
C.子类不能定义与父类名同名同形参得方法,否则,系统将不知道使
用哪种方法
D.重载就就是一个类中有多个同名但有不同形参与方法体得方法
知识点: 第三单元过关自测
学生答
案:
[D;]
得分: [5] 试题分
值:
5、0
提示:
4.在调用构造函数时,____
A.子类可以不加定义就使用父类得所有构造函数
B.不管类中就是否定义了何种构造函数,创建对象时都可以使用默认
构造函数
C.先调用父类得构造函数
D.先调用形参多得构造函数
知识点: 第三单元过关自测
学生答
案:
[A;]
得分: [5] 试题分
值:
5、0
提示:
5.方法得作用不包含____
A.使程序结构清晰
B.功能复用
C.代码简洁
D.重复代码
知识点: 第三单元过关自测
学生答
案:
[D;]
得分: [5] 试题分
值:
5、0
提示:
6.构造函数在____时被调用
A.创建对象时
B.类定义时
C.使用对象得方法时
D.使用对象得属性时
知识点: 第三单元过关自测学生答
案:
[A;]
得分: [5] 试题分
值:
5、0
提示:
7.return语句____
A.可以让方法返回数值
B.方法都必须包含
C.方法中不可以有多个return语句
D.不能用来返回对象
知识点: 第三单元过关自测
学生答
案:
[A;]
得分: [5] 试题分
值:
5、0
提示:
8.方法得形参____
A.必须定义多个形参
B.至少有一个
C.可以没有
D.只能就是简单变量
知识点: 第三单元过关自测
学生答
案:
[C;]
得分: [5] 试题分
值:
5、0
提示:
9.方法内得变量____
A.一定在方法内所有位置可见
B.可能在方法内得局部可见
C.可以在方法外可见
D.方法外也可以
知识点: 第三单元过关自测
学生答
案:
[B;]
得分: [5] 试题分
值:
5、0
提示:
10.下列声明正确得就是____
A.Abstract final class Hh{……}
B.Abstract private move(){……}
C.Protected private number;
D.Public abstract class Car{……}
知识点: 第三单元过关自测
学生答
案:
[B;]
得分: [5] 试题分
值:
5、0
提示:
11.被声明为private,protected及public得类成员,在类外部____
A.只能访问声明为public得成员
B.只能访问到声明为protected与public得成员
C.都可以访问
D.都不可以访问
知识点: 第三单元过关自测
学生答
案:
[A;]
得分: [5] 试题分
值:
5、0
提示:
12.关于main()得说法正确得就是____
A.方法main()只能放在公共类中
B.方法main()得头定义可以根据情况任意更改
C.一个类中可以没有main()方法
D.所有对象得创建都必须放在main()方法中
知识点: 第三单元过关自测
学生答
案:
[C;]
得分: [5] 试题分
值:
5、0
提示: